Transaction 2c242312b9fbc39f9209f569dd6371b10525e772b0ccc36d2316fe09596abe85
3 Input
2 Outputs
- 2c242312b9fbc39f9209f569dd6371b10525e772b0ccc36d2316fe09596abe85:0
- 2c242312b9fbc39f9209f569dd6371b10525e772b0ccc36d2316fe09596abe85:1
value 539958
address 1NQhP7JNmn8DNbosQoaDytPmLwf64oy3An
value 3346909
address 18Xc93xXYkrWjrPms6Z7xcakFTZNfGwGFG